Ethernet kapcsolat beállítása TNCremoNT és iTNC 530 között

RS232 és Ethernet alapú megoldások
Avatar
go98admin
Adminisztrátor
Hozzászólások: 376
Csatlakozott: 2016.08.18. 23:17

Ethernet kapcsolat beállítása TNCremoNT és iTNC 530 között

HozzászólásSzerző: go98admin » 2016.08.21. 15:19

Ellenőrizzük az adatátviteli kábelt! Amennyiben a vezérlő és a számítógép között közvetlen összeköttetés van, akkor fordítós (Crossed) kábelt kell alkalmaznunk. Egyéb esetben (HUB, router, stb. közbeiktatásakor) egyenes (Straight) kábelre van szükség.

Első lépésként az iTNC 530 vezérlés IP címét kell beállítani, illetve megnézni.
Lépjünk a Kép programszerkesztés üzemmódba (egy NC program legyen megnyitva szerkesztésre), majd nyomjuk meg a Kép gombot.
Adjuk meg a NET123 kulcsszámot.
A képernyő átvált a Hálózati beállítás módba.
Nyomjuk meg a DEFINE NET funkcióbillentyűt. A vezérlés megnyitja az ip4.n00 táblázatot.
A legfelső sorban balra a Fájl:ip4.n00, míg jobbra az ACT:0 látható. Ez utóbbi azt jelenti, hogy a 0-ás sor az aktív. Ennek természetesen csak akkor van jelentősége, ha egynél több sorból állna a táblázat.
A táblázat ADDRESS oszlopában a vezérlő IP címe látható, a MASK oszlop pedig az alhálózati maszkot tartalmazza. Jelen esetben ezek 192.168.39.7 és 255.255.255.0. A számítógép IP címének is ebbe a tartományba kell esnie, azaz 192.168.39.X, ahol az X nem nagyobb 255-nél és nem lehet 7 (mert akkor megegyezne a vezérlő címével). Amennyiben az aktuális értékek ezt nem teljesítik, úgy vagy a vezérlés, vagy a számítógép IP címét meg kell változtatni. A többi oszlop értékei lényegtelenek, ha a vezérlő és a számítógép közvetlenül vagy egy HUB-on keresztül kapcsolódik. Egyéb esetben például szükség lehet a ROUTER és más oszlopok kitöltésére, kérje a hálózat rendszergazdájának segítségét.
Figyelem! Amennyiben a vezérlés IP címét megváltoztatjuk, akkor a Hálózati beállításból kilépve a gép újraindul.
Az Kép gombbal lépjünk ki a Hálózati beállítás módból.
Megjegyzések a számítógép IP címének beállításához: A számítógép IP címét a Hálózati helyek ikonra bal egérgombbal kattintva a Tulajdonságok funkcióval elérhető Hálózati kapcsolatok ablakban lehet elérni. Válasszuk ki azt a kapcsolatot, amelyen keresztül a vezérlést elérjük (valószínüleg ez a Helyi kapcsolat lesz). Ezen az ikonon is a bal egérgombbal hívjuk meg a Tulajdonságok funkciót. A megjelenő ablak Álatalános lapján a TCP/IP protokoll kijelölése után a Tulajdonságok gombra kattintva láthatjuk a beállított IP-címet és egyéb értékeket. Ha az itt beállított értékeket nem szabad megváltoztatnunk, mert azok például az internet eléréséhez kellenek, akkor használjuk az Alternatív konfiguráció lapon megadható IP-címet és Alhálózati maszkot.

Második lépésként a TNCremo (verzió: TNCremo v2.8, TNCremo v3.2) program Extras/Configuration menüjében a Connection lapon ellenőrizzük, hogy az Ethernet connection (TCP/IP) legyen kiválasztva, majd a Settings lapon az IP Address/Host Name mezőbe írjuk be a vezérlés IP címét (példánkban 192.168.39.7).
Ezek után a TNCremoNT programmal a vezérlő merevlemeze elérhető a File/Connect parancs használatával.

Avatar
go98admin
Adminisztrátor
Hozzászólások: 376
Csatlakozott: 2016.08.18. 23:17

Adatátvitel beállítása TNC310-nél

HozzászólásSzerző: go98admin » 2016.08.21. 15:32

Nádler László 2009. jan. 18. 15:35 #7
Tisztelettel kérnék segítséget a következő adatátviteli problémához. TNC310 es vezérlésnél a TNC ből RS232 porton keresztül PC-re hibátlanul kiküldök kb. 300 karakter hosszúságú programot.
A TNC ben kitörlöm vagy átnevezem a kiküldött programot. Ezután a PC-ről ugyanazt a programot visszaküldöm a TNC-be. A bevitel hibátlanul megtörténik de az átvitel után a monitor nem kezelhető, nem lehet képernyőt váltani. A gépet (vezérlőt) ki kell kapcsolni. Bekapcsolás után a program könyvtárat kijeleztetve és a bevitt programot kilistázva a program hibátlanul a vezérlő memóriájában van.
TNC beállítása: EXT1, Baud :4800 MP 5020.0:%0010101000, MP5020.1:%0010101000, MP5020.2:%0010101000,
A PC-n használt adatátviteli program:V24
A V24 beállítása: 4800baud 7bit 1 stopbit parity:even XON/XOFF
Tisztelettel Nádler László

go98 2009. jan. 18. 22:51 #8
Javasolt megoldás a TNCremoNT program TNCserver kiegészítésének használata. Az adatátviteli sebesség és az FE protokoll beállításán kívül csak az adatátviteli kábel helyes bekötésére kell ügyelni. Használatával minden művelet a TNC-ről elvégezhető, a PC-n nem kell semmit sem kezelni.
Mivel a V24 programot nem szoktam használni és nem is ismerem, ezért csak találgathatok, mindazonáltal egy külső eszközről EXT protokollal küldött programnak valahogy így kellene jönnie:
< NUL >< NUL >
Első sor PGM100< CR >< LF >
...
Utolsó sor PGM 100 < CR >< LF >< ETX >
Minden bizonnyal az átvitelt lezáró < End of TeXt > kódra vár a TNC, azért nem lehet kezdeni vele semmit.
Az EXT módnak még az a hátránya is megvan, hogy nincs ellenőrző összeg az átküldött mondatokhoz fűzve, ezért fennáll a veszélye a hibás adatátvitelnek.
Megjegyzés: az adatátviteli sebességet nyugodtan lehet növelni a TNC310 által elfogadott 57600 baud maximumig.

Nádler László 2009. feb. 09. 15:07 #9
Köszönöm a TNC310-el kapcsolatos segítséget. Az átvitel TNCremoNT-vel jól működik.
Másik gépünkön TNC155v típusú vezérlő van. A TNCremoNT programmal tudunk adatot a memóriába bevinni ill. kivinni. Azonban ha túl hosszú programunk van (kb.120000 byte) és "Blockweises Übertragen" módban akarunk dolgozni az adatátvitel elindul, a képernyőn megjelennek az első programsorok, a megmunkálást cyklus starttal el tudjuk indítani. A számítógépen azonban az adatküldés nem áll le, hanem mind a 120000 byte kiküldésre kerül. A megmunkálás pedig egy idő után "Fehlerhafte programdaten" hibával leáll.
A TNC155v NC Software Nr.:22706009
Paraméterek a TNC155V-ben:P71:515, P218:17736, P219:16712, P220:279, P221:5382, P222:168, P223:1, P224:4, BAUD:2400
TNCremoNT Beállítása: Steurungtyp:TNC155A/P vagy TNC155B/Q, COM1, BAUD:2400, FE mód,
TNCremo programot használva sem működik jól.
Mi lehet a probléma?
Előre is köszönöm szíves segítségét: Nádler László

go98 2009. feb. 10. 19:56 #10
A paraméterek beállítása helyes. A kábel bekötése is jó? Nincsenek visszaforgatva az RTS/CTS, DSR/DTR jelek?

Nádler László 2009. feb. 11. 06:55 #11
A Heidenhain honlapján lévő TNC155 vezérlésnél
a "Schnittstellen" file-ban a DSR/DTR jelek visszakötését javasolja TNC145-TNC155 vezérlőknél.
TNC oldalon a 25pólusú csatlakozón a 6,8,20, lábak a PC oldalon a 9 pólusú csatlakozón a 1,4,6, lábak vannak visszaforgatva.
Lehet, hogy ez a baj?
Üdvözlettel: Nádler László

go98 2009. feb. 11. 15:36 #12
Emlékeim szerint azt az átkötést hardver átvitelvezérlésnél javasolja a leírás, de itt az MP222 paraméter bit3-ja magas, azaz szoftver átvitelvezérlés van. Próbáljuk meg az általános kábelbekötést használni (lásd #4). Bár igazából azok a jelek csak az ellen állomás üzemkészségét jeleznék...

go98 2009. márc. 03. 19:20 #13
"Megoldódott" az egyes TNC155 vezérlőknél jelentkező DNC probléma.
A TNC151T, TNC155F, TNC151W, TNC155W, TNC151FR, TNC155FR, TNC151WR, TNC155WR, TNC151E, TNC155E, TNC151V, TNC155V, TNC151ER, TNC155ER, TNC151VR és TNC155VR típusok sem DNC-re, sem 3D-s mozgásra nem képesek.

Avatar
go98admin
Adminisztrátor
Hozzászólások: 376
Csatlakozott: 2016.08.18. 23:17

Teljes mentés TNC410 vezérlésnél

HozzászólásSzerző: go98admin » 2016.08.21. 15:35

FÓRIÁN ZOLTÁN 2010. okt. 19. 19:57 #14
Segítséget kérnék a következő problémára,TNC 410-es vezérlőből szeretném a plc adatokat kimenteni.A gyártótól kapott flopi vszeg sérült és nem olvasható. AZ adatátvitel TNCremoNT-val történik.NC szoftver szám:286 060 09
Tisztelettel: Fórián Zoltán

go98 2010. okt. 19. 23:49 #15
A TNC410 vezérlésben a PLC program vagy RAM-ban, vagy EPROM-ban van. Az MP4010 paraméter dönti el, mivel van dolgunk; 0=EPROM, 1=RAM. Ha a PLC program EPROM-ban van, akkor nincs teendőnk vele (persze elképzelhető, hogy az EPROM is elromlik).
A 286 060 20 (de/en), illetve ennek magyar nyelvű változata a 286 071 20 (hu/en) szoftver már ismeri a BACKUP és RESTORE funkciókat, melyek a 369741 kód megadása után elérhetőek és értelemszerűen használhatóak. A BACKUP funkció elmenti az alábbi állományokat:
- gépi paramétereket (MP.MP)
- PLC programot (PLC.PLC)
- nemlineáris korrekciós táblázatokat (*.CMA, *COM)
- TT, TS, HR, RS232C beállítási paramétereit (NCDATA.SYS)
- aktuálisan kijelölt állományok (NCPATH.SYS)
- üzemidő számlálók (TIMES.SYS)
- nullapontok, pont táblázatok, szerszám és hely táblázatok

Jelen esetben ez a funkció még nem használható, ezért a fenti adatok közül a paraméterek, PLC (ha RAM-ban van), nemlineáris hibakorrekciók (ha van), és az utolsó sorban felsorolt táblázatok külön-külön archiválandók.

A PLC program a 807667 kód megadása után hasonlóan menthető mint a technológiai programok (TNC szerver alkalmazás). A nemlineáris korrekciók a 105296 kód megadása után érhetők el, míg a táblázatok (nullapont, szerszám, hely) a technológiai programok mintájára kódszám használata nélkül kiírhatók.

Avatar
go98admin
Adminisztrátor
Hozzászólások: 376
Csatlakozott: 2016.08.18. 23:17

TNC155 soros beállítás

HozzászólásSzerző: go98admin » 2016.08.21. 15:39

Borgi 2012. jún. 27. 04:01 #17
Tisztelettel kérdék segítséget a következő probléma megoldásához.
Van egy Metba-45-D típusu gépünk amin TNC-155-Q típusú vezérlő van. A TNCremoNT programmal tudunk adatot a memóriába bevinni illetve onnan kivinni.
Azonban nekem a lényeges az lenne, hogy PC-ről DNC vezérlést ám sajnos nem találtam leírás, a történet mikéntjére. Ebben szeretnék egy kis segítséget kérni.
A TNC-155-Q NC Software Nr.: 234020 02
PLC Software Nr.: 234970 03
Előre is köszönöm szíves segítségét: Légrádi Gábor

go98 2012. jún. 27. 23:03 #18
Például a TNC155Q angol leírása a 336-dik oldaltól részletezi a DNC üzemmódot (a Heidenhain Transfer blockwise üzemmódnak nevezi a DNC-t).
A TNC155Q vezérlés leírásai itt megtalálhatóak: http://content.heidenhain.de/doku/oma_controls/dvd_oma_html/de/index/N12DA1/N12E50/N140B6/N140B6.html
A TNCremoNT programcsomag TNCserver alkalmazásával FE üzemmódban lehet a vezérlést folyamatosan adatokkal ellátni.

Borgi 2012. jún. 28. 05:10 #19
Ezt máris köszönöm. Azt nem tudod esetleg, hogy a gépi paramétereknél mely beállításoknak hogyan kell lennie? Mert én nyomkodom nagyban amit leír a kézikönyv de "Taste Ohne Funktion" hibaüzenetet kapom folyamatosan...
Előre is Köszönöm Tisztelettel Légrádi Gábor

Avatar
go98admin
Adminisztrátor
Hozzászólások: 376
Csatlakozott: 2016.08.18. 23:17

Ethernet kapcsolat beállítása TNCremoNT és TNC426 között

HozzászólásSzerző: go98admin » 2016.08.21. 15:45

Borgi 2013. jan. 25. 19:58 #30
Sziasztok.
TNC 426/430 vezérlést szeretnék összehozni winXP rendszerrel, Ethernet kábelen úgy hogy a vezérlőn Hálózatba kapcsolással lehessen letölteni a programokat és ne pc-ről kelljen áttölteni. Van valakinek tapasztalata erre? iTNC 530-al össze sikerül hoznom, de a 426/230 a következő hibát dobja mindig ki:
"Error from portmapper" és "can't open port" van ötletetek mi lehet a hiba?

go98 2013. jan. 25. 21:16 #31
Az adatátviteli módokról és beállításokról angolul és németül itt lehet olvasni bővebben, ha már ilyen általános a kérdés. Csak halkan jegyzem meg, hogy a CIMCO-nak volt egy erre a célra használható programja. A vezérlés szoftververziói is eléggé eltérő képességekkel rendelkeztek a hálózathoz kapcsolódás terén...

Avatar
go98admin
Adminisztrátor
Hozzászólások: 376
Csatlakozott: 2016.08.18. 23:17

Teljes mentés iTNC530 vezérlésnél

HozzászólásSzerző: go98admin » 2016.08.21. 15:55

joco81 2015. dec. 10. 10:32 #39
Üdv!
iTNC 530-nál, hogy lehet teljes biztonsági mentést készíteni? - TNC, PLC,...stb
Olyan mentést szeretnék, amiből a gép "teljes halála" után újra feléleszthető.
Joco81

go98 2015. dec. 10. 20:22 #40
A TNCremo programmal. Lásd az Extras -> Backup/Restore... menüpontot és a program helpjében a részleteket.

joco81 2015. dec. 11. 08:44 #41
Köszönöm!
A TNCRemo alapesetben csak a TNC meghajtót engedi menteni/olvasni. A PLC kód megadásával teljes hozzáférést kapok a vezérlő meghajtóihoz?
Elegendő a PLC meghajtó teljes lementése a gép esetleges későbbi teljes visszaállításához.

go98 2015. dec. 11. 22:27 #42
A TNCremo teljes mentés (*.*) készítésénél természetesen kéri a PLC jelszót. Ezt a gépgyártótól érdemes megkérdezni, mivel a gépgyártó meg tudja változtatni az alapértelmezettet.
A PLC meghajtó nem tartalmazza a teljes információt, nem elegendő csak annak a mentése (mind a teljes, mind a gépspecifikus mentés a PLC könyvtáron kívül a SYS könyvtárból is ment adatokat).
A TNCremo-val létrehozott mentés sem tartalmaz azonban mindent. Régebbi vezérléseknél szükség lehet a SETUP lemezekre (nyelvi verziók, ábrák), iTNC530 és utána következő vezérlésekhez pedig a Heidenhain tud adni adathordozót (merevlemez, FLASH kártya), amin már installálva van az operációs rendszer.

joco81 2015. dec. 12. 00:06 #43
A vezérlés: iTNC530 340490-03 SP3
A cél egy olyan mentés készítése, melyből vissza lehet hozni a gépet .
Kizárólag a gépspecifikus beállítások kellenek. - Több beállítás, hangolás a helyszínen készült, s nincs róla mentés.
Sajnos a gyártó átesett több tulajdonosváltáson, s nem igazán van támogatás tőlük.

go98 2015. dec. 13. 11:59 #44
Teljes mentést készíteni a TNCremo lentebb említett funkciójával lehet. Ennek birtokában kiképzett szervizszakember (a meghibásodott adathordozó cseréje után) képes visszaállítani a gép működőképességét.
Mentésnél a PLC jelszó hiányában a Heidenhain hotline tud napi jelszót mondani, mellyel -aznap- a mentés elvégezhető.

Danika20i
Hozzászólások: 5
Csatlakozott: 2018.02.15. 15:22

Re: Ethernet kapcsolat beállítása TNCremoNT és iTNC 530 között

HozzászólásSzerző: Danika20i » 2018.03.19. 08:06

Üdvözlöm! Olyat szeretnek kérdezni hogy egy tnc 155 vezérlőn ha pcről küldöm az adatokat dnc üzemmódban azaz (csepegtetem). Ennek van valami memória korlatja? Egy 3200 soros programot simán futtatam igy. De elképzelhető hogy mondjuk egy 6000 soros programot mar nem tudnék?

Avatar
GO98
Hozzászólások: 57
Csatlakozott: 2016.08.18. 23:31

Re: Ethernet kapcsolat beállítása TNCremoNT és iTNC 530 között

HozzászólásSzerző: GO98 » 2018.03.20. 17:35

Nincs semmilyen korlát a programsorokra nézve.
Amelyik TNC15x tud 3 tengely mentén egyszerre mozogni, az képes bármekkora programot végrehajtani DNC üzemmódban.

Danika20i
Hozzászólások: 5
Csatlakozott: 2018.02.15. 15:22

Re: Ethernet kapcsolat beállítása TNCremoNT és iTNC 530 között

HozzászólásSzerző: Danika20i » 2018.03.21. 12:33

Igen Köszönöm! Tegnap kipróbáltam egy 10000 soros programot és szepen ment is de nálam is előállt az a hiba hogy kb 3000 sortól belassul.. nem fut egyenletesen. Szinte majdnem minden 3ik sornál megáll gondolkozni egy kicsit! Nem tudom miből eredhet!